On Tue, Apr 27, 2010 at 02:41:09PM +0800, Huang Ying wrote:
>
> This patchset adds the APEI (ACPI Platform Error Interface) support to
> Linux kernel.
>
> 01-06 include the basic APEI HEST parsing and EINJ support. They have
> been posted to mailing list before and get some reviews and
> ACKs. Changes since the last post are as follow.
>
> - Make APEI infrastructure and HEST parsing configurable built-in
> instead of modules to solve some dependency issues.
>
> - Some minor fixes, such as printk
>
> 07-10 are newly added to support GHES (Generic Hardware Error Source)
> corrected memory error. On some machines, Machine Check can not report
> physical address for some corrected memory errors, but GHES can do
> that. So this simplified GHES is implemented and posted firstly.
I read all the code again and it looks all good to go for .35 to me.
Reviewed-by: Andi Kleen <ak@linux.intel.com>
-Andi
